你查询的IP:[119.78.184.51]  地理位置:中国科技网

最新查询210.21.252.46 58.24.180.21 116.2.55.36 119.28.187.33 125.32.233.42 58.66.56.55 121.192.21.158 124.112.247.125 221.12.2.22 119.78.184.51 119.235.128.86 121.55.187.87 203.156.192.0 118.184.12.240 119.176.223.216 202.120.18.239 220.232.64.34 117.21.47.28 218.185.192.104 61.48.60.21 210.14.128.62 119.75.208.207 202.46.224.79 221.12.14.225 124.42.90.137 210.22.128.173 122.248.48.149 123.108.128.202 125.31.192.146 118.180.0.42 123.177.222.148